Endothermic reaction
Sequence of shots showing an endothermic reaction. At top left solid barium hydroxide and solid ammonium chloride have been place in a flask that is sitting on a damp piece of wood. The digital thermometer shows the temperature in the flask to be 21 degrees Celsius. As the two chemicals are mixed an endothermic, or heat-absorbing, reaction takes place and the temperature inside the beaker drops dramatically. This drop in temperature freezes the water between the flask and wooden block, sticking the two together (bottom right).
